use-context相关内容
我使用useContext管理导航栏的状态时遇到问题。只要菜单切换,ATM My应用程序就会呈现菜单项。我希望此事件仅发生在onClick上,并且按钮不记录控制台日志消息,它只有在我直接单击链接项目例如:Home时才起作用。 所以我有两个问题。如何管理导航栏状态以显示如何隐藏菜单项,而不必为其创建新组件? 我如何修复我的Click事件,因为它在菜单按钮本身或/和菜单项上触发? 下面您将为App.j
..
我不明白为什么我的 useContext 没有在这个函数中被调用: import { useContext } from “react";import { MyContext } from "../contexts/MyContext.js";从“axios"导入 axios;const baseURL = "...";const axiosInstance = axios.create({ba
..
我有一个 GlobalContext.js 文件.我想通过使用名为“global"的变量来达到这一部分.在我的主屏幕中.但它没有看到.我的错误在哪里? 我认为我所做的是正确的,但它不起作用 这里是 GlobalContext.js import React, { createContext, useContext, useState } from 'react';从“../compo
..
我正在使用 useContext 钩子来制作共享状态的组件到其他组件. 现在这个组件也将状态保存到本地存储. var initialState = {头像:'/static/uploads/profile-avatars/placeholder.jpg',isRoutingVisible: 假,removeRoutingMachine:假,标记:[],当前地图:{}};var UserCo
..
如果 React Context API 旨在用于传递全局变量,为什么我们要使用它们来替代从父组件到子组件的传递道具(道具钻取)?由于大多数传递的 props 并不意味着在应用程序范围内可用,即全局可用. 解决方案 上下文中定义的变量或值可用于任何试图解构这些值的组件.但是,如果您有任何更改这些定义值的 setter,则只有传递给 Provider 的子项才会获得更新的值. 例如,如
..
我是 React 新手,我想在我的班级中使用 useContext,我该如何解决这个问题?这是我当前代码的示例 import { Context } from '../context/ChatListContext'const ChatList = ({ onAction }) =>{const {state, fetchChatList} = useContext(Context) 我对我的
..
我是 react-admin 的新手,我正在尝试构建自定义图片库输入.它应该显示一个带有图像的模式(数据已经被提取并存储在 redux 中),以便用户可以选择一个或多个图像(选择后,一个动作被调度来更新减速器的值),我需要这些选择的图像 ID 在转换中 上的函数,以便我可以在调用 dataProvider 方法之前添加所需的数据. 但我有一个奇怪的问题,这可能是因为我缺乏反
..
我在Next.js中将 useReducer 与 useContext 结合使用时遇到问题.我想使用用户已经通过 useReducer 和 useContext 制作的令牌,但是当我尝试使用它时,它是不确定的.我不知道该怎么办? 这是我的代码文件: 此代码用于从Next.js的api文件夹中获取令牌(无论如何,我正在使用 next-connect ): 从'../../../util
..
我有简单的商店 import React, { createContext, useReducer } from "react"; import Reducer from "./UserReducer"; const initialState = { user: {}, error: null }; const Store = ({ children }) => {
..